Day 21: Child's Play (Chucky) Franchise.

The Plot: Child's Play is a movie directed by Tom Holland. Starring: Alex Vincent as Andy. Catherine Hicks as Karen. Chris Sarandon as Mike. Brad Dourif as Charles Lee Ray/ (voice of) Chucky. The sequels were directed by all different directors such as: John Lafia. Jack Bender. Ronny Yu. Don Mancini (Who also wrote all of the movies). The sequels starred: Yet again Alex Vincent as Andy, and Brad Dourif as Charles Lee Ray/ (voice of) Chucky. Also featuring: Jenny Agutter as Joanne. Gerrit Graham as Phil. Christine Elise (One of my favourite actresses) as Kyle. Justin Whalin as Teenage Andy. Perrey Reeves as De Silva. Jeremy Sylvers as Tyler. Jennifer Tilly as Tiffany and herself. Katherine Heigl as Jade. Nick Stabile as Jesse. Billy Boyd as (voice of) Glen/Glenda. Redman as Himself. Hannah Spearritt as Joan. Fiona Dourif as Nica. Chantal Quesnelle as Sarah. Danielle Bisutti as Barb. A Martinez as Frank. Maitland McConnell as Jill. Brennan Elliot. The Original is about a little boy Andy, who gets a Good Guy Doll for his Birthday. But as soon as he gets the doll, terrible stuff start to happen. And before he knows it he is in a battle to stay alive. The second and third movie follows Andy, the little boy from the original being stalked by Chucky again. The fourth installment focuses more on Chucky. Bride of Chucky. Chucky and Tiffany just goin around killin people. The seed of Chucky. Chucky has a kid, who doesn't like killing. So Chucky and Tiffany decide to teach they're kid how to kill people. And then there's the Curse of Chucky which came out just a few weeks ago. The first movie to not have a Theatrical Release due to poor income from Seed of Chucky. The Curse of Chucky, goes back to it's dark roots, and shows Chucky and his dark side again. They are all good movies, which made Chucky to what he is today, a Horror Icon. Day 22: Paranormal Activity Quadrilogy
                           
The Plot: Paranormal Activity is a movie directed and written by Oren Peli. Starring: Katie Featherston as Katie. Micah Slot as Micah. The sequels were directed by different directors such as: Tod Williams. Henry Joost. Ariel Schulman. Starring: Katie Featherson again and other stars such as: Brian Boland as Daniel. Molly Ephraim as Ali. Seth Ginsberg as Brad. Sprague Grayden as Kristi. Lauren Bittner as Julie. Chris Smith as Dennis. Chloe Csengery as Young Katie. Jessica Brown as Young Kristi. Kathryn Newton as Alex. Matt Shively as Ben. Aiden Lovekamp as Wyatt. Brady Allen as Robbie/Hunter. The Original is about a couple moving into a new house, and slowly start to notice Paranormal Activity, they film everything. Katie slowly gets possessed, until there's nothing anyone can do to help her. The Sequels are all just backstories and contuations of the Original. Like the Second Installment begins as a Prequel and ends as a Follow up to the Original. The Third Installment is a Prequel that show's Katie and Kristi as children. And the Fourth Installment is not so much focused on Katie and Kristi anymore but more on the son of Kristi, that was kidnapped by Katie in the sequel. So Katie and Kristi's son (Hunter) move across the street of Alex, and it shows how Hunter stalks the family of Alex. And the demon's he possesses. The Fifth.... well let's just say the Marked Ones is coming out in January, it's pretty much an alone standing movie, not much to do with the other 4. But All the movies did great in the box office, and the series still has a huge fan base, that are begging for more.

Day 23: Grave Encounters (Original + Sequel)
                         

The Plot: Grave Encounters is a movie directed by The Vicious Brothers. And the sequel being directed by John Poliquin. The Original Starred: Ben Wilkinson as Jerry. Sean Rogerson as Lance. Ashleigh Gryzko as Sasha. Merwin Mondesir as T.C. Juan Riedinger as Matt. The sequel starred: Richard Harmon as Alex. Dylan Playfair as Trevor. Stephanie Bennett as Tessa. Howie Lai as Jared. Leanne Lapp as Jennifer. The original is about a Ghost Hunting crew that goes and investagates in Collingwood Psychiatric Hospital, which has been abandonned for years. And soon they find themselves locked in the building, and everything evil inside it. The sequel shows fans of the movie breaking into the Hospital to take a look for themselves, and also find themselves locked in. But ofcourse the Makers of the movie wanted something new, so they took the Fantasy route, and made it into something way different then the original, which some people lvoed and other people hated.
